Human rights activist, Aisha Yesufu, on Wednesday accused governors and Minister of Information of speaking for terrorists in the country.

The co-convener of the BringBackOurGirls movement in her statement also called out religious leaders for speaking for terrorists.

Yesufu made this claim while speaking at the Nigerian Bar Association, NBA, annual law week in Calabar, Cross River State.

She called on professional bodies to wake up to its responsibilities of defending citizens.

Advertisement

She said: “Terrorists have governors speaking for them, they have the Minister of Information, religious rulers all speaking up for them. Who do citizens have speaking up for them?”

“The professional bodies, most especially the NBA must wake up to its responsibilities.”
